What Are French Doors?French doors are usually characterized by two hinged doors that open inward or outside, including big glass panes. learn more optimizes light however likewise develops an airy and open feel in a space. The origins of French doors trace back to the Renaissance duration in France, where they were commonly utilized in grand estates to connect indoor areas with gardens or outdoor patios.

Timeless French doors are the ultimate style that the majority of people picture. They usually feature 2 doors with several glass panes separated by wooden or metal grids. This style works wonderfully in traditional or official settings, offering a stylish shift in between spaces.
Sliding French Doors
Sliding French doors are a modern adjustment that maximizes area effectiveness. One door slides on a track and overlaps the other, ideal for homes where traditional swinging doors might not fit. They are typically utilized in locations that open to outside areas, offering an unblocked view.
French Patio Doors
French patio doors are developed particularly for access to outside locations. They often come wider than standard doors, making it easy to move furniture in and out. These doors can be timeless or modern, depending upon the homeowner's taste.
Folding French Doors
Folding French doors, or bi-fold doors, include numerous panels that fold back when opened. This design is perfect for those looking to produce an expansive opening to the outdoors, making it ideal for amusing or enjoying a smooth transition from inside to outside.
Contemporary French Doors
For those leaning towards modern visual appeals, modern French doors use sleek lines and minimalistic designs. They typically utilize large panes of glass with narrow frames, enhancing the natural light that gets in the space.
Painted or Stained French Doors
Modification is key when choosing French doors. House owners can select to paint or stain their doors to match existing decor. This style adds a distinct touch, permitting creative expression.
Considerations When Choosing French DoorsChoosing the ideal French door design includes numerous considerations. Below is a list of factors that house owners need to bear in mind:
- Space Availability: Evaluate the area where the doors will be set up. Think about whether swinging, sliding, or folding doors will work best.
- Home Style: The architectural style of your home is vital for guaranteeing that the doors match the general style.
- Product: French doors been available in wood, fiberglass, aluminum, and vinyl. Each product has its advantages and disadvantages in terms of sturdiness, maintenance, and cost.
- Glass Type: Options include clear, frosted, or tempered glass for safety and privacy considerations.
- Energy Efficiency: Look for doors with energy-efficient glass to help with insulation and reduce utility bills.
- Budget: Determine your budget as French doors can differ widely in cost depending upon material and style.
Q1: How much do French doors generally cost?
- The cost of French doors can range anywhere from ₤ 500 to ₤ 5,000 or more, depending upon the materials and custom features.
Q2: Are French doors energy effective?
- Numerous French doors are created with energy effectiveness in mind, featuring double or triple-pane glass and quality framing.
Q3: Do French doors require special maintenance?
- Upkeep depends upon the product. Wooden doors might need routine painting or staining, while fiberglass or vinyl doors require less maintenance.
Q4: Can French doors be set up in any opening?
- French doors can be set up in most openings, however the size and structure of the frame must be considered. Consultation with a professional can assist figure out feasibility.
Q5: What's the best way to secure French doors?
- For added security, consider extra locking systems, such as deadbolts and multi-point locking systems. Adding a security screen can likewise boost security.
